Performance Capabilities
When it comes to performance, the 9950X3D boasts 16 cores and 32 unlocked threads, showcasing its prowess in handling multitasking and heavy workloads. This processor can achieve a boost frequency of up to 5.7 GHz, making it particularly well-suited for intense gaming and creative tasks. On the other hand, the 9900X offers 12 cores and 24 threads with a maximum boost frequency of 5.6 GHz. While both processors excel, the 9950X3D's higher core count and boost frequency provide a distinct advantage for users requiring peak performance.

Cache Size
The cache size is another area where the 9950X3D stands out, featuring a total of 144 MB of L2/L3 cache. This larger cache significantly improves data access speeds, enhancing overall system performance, particularly in demanding applications. In contrast, the 9900X has a smaller L3 cache of 76 MB. While the 9900X still performs admirably, the substantial difference in cache size provides the 9950X3D with a notable advantage in scenarios that require rapid data retrieval.
